Play as mother nature and use a variety of different abilities to figure out how to start fires and burn down the woods. But watch out! Humans have moved in and they're putting out too many fires - are you clever enough to outsmart them and help usher in new growth?
Occasional small to mid-sized forest fires are natural and ecologically beneficial for forests and other ecosystems. In this game you'll get to see that effect play out and help encourage environmental rebirth.
*(The 'limited space' in this game is in reference to the small size of the board and the generally limited amount of forest as a result of deforestation)*
CONTROLS:
Use WASD to pan camera, mouse wheel to zoom, and hold right click to rotate your view. Select abilities with left click and activate them by clicking on a tile. Press R to reset or rotate (wind ability only), and press I to see more detailed instructions:
